THOMMEN AC32 Digital Air Data Computers drive Sagem AMLCD Displays in Sikorsky S-61 STC done by Carson helicopters
 
|back|
 
 

Waldenburg, Switzerland THOMMEN’s AC32 Digital Air Data Computers were chosen by Vector Aerospace of Langley, B.C., Canada, for the integration of the glass cockpit design for the Sikorsky S-61.  The system integrates Primary Flight Instruments, EICAS -Engine Instruments/Caution Advisory System and other Multifunction Display system functions such as moving maps, enhanced vision, TOPS - Terrain Obstacle Proximity System, and route information.

The Sagem Glass Display’s have been integrated into numerous retrofit rotary wing applications.  Integrated digital cockpits like the new S-61 aircraft also significantly lower maintenance and repair costs while improving reliability. 

 

This unique installation is part of a modernization program launched by Frank Carson who is internationally recognized as a pioneer in the helicopter industry.

 

REVUE THOMMEN AG, based in Waldenburg, Switzerland, is a leading manufacturer of aircraft instruments and air data systems used worldwide on a full range of aircraft types from helicopters to corporate aircraft and commercial airliners. THOMMEN is AS9100, ISO 9001:2000, EASA Part 21 and EASA Part 145 certified. Additional company information is available at www.THOMMEN.aero.
